As to those who deal in foodstuffs who wish barter their goods, the barter must
be concluded in one sitting, whether the foods to be bartered are different kinds
or not. But if they are from the same kind, then they should exchange them and
observe the like quality.
Third: As Salam Contract (i.e. sale in, which price is paid for goods to be
delivered later)
The trader must observe ten conditions with regard to the As Salam Contract:
First: The value of the contract must be known so that he dealing does not
exceed them, if the delivery is not made in due time the injured party can return a
claim against this value.
